Which reminds me of a book I recently reviewed. Have you “met” Holly Gerth through this online world? She loves Jesus and writes as one gifted by her Maker. And she just released an encouraging, new book called “You’re Already Amazing“. Let me just say, I read it in two days. Which for this slow-reading, no-free-time girl, that means it must be good.

 

720605: You"re Already Amazing: Embracing Who You Are, Becoming All God Created You to Be You’re Already Amazing: Embracing Who You Are, Becoming All God Created You to Be
By Holley Gerth

 

In it she touches on that comparison pit we as women often fall into. And how God already made you and me amazing. He designed us and equipped us for the call He graciously placed upon us. He gives us the skills to accomplish His will. I could go on and on. But ultimately she inspires the reader to be the *you* that He created. Let’s just say, I highly recommend it for your Spring and Summer reading list.
